A really cool project I came across on the HPI website, drive an rc car through the Nevada desert from Barstow to Vegas, that's about 200km!
HPI wanted to demonstrate that their Baja 5B 1/5th scale off road petrol buggy can handle this tough environment. One of their employees started it as a joke driving the car up a mountain while steering it from the passenger seat of a full size car. Then they came up with the idea of doing a big drive through the desert as a promotional stunt. To see if the car held up and made it, check out the whole story, nice pictures and a video of the trip on the HPI website .
